Intraoral Scanner Technologies - Sorts and FunctionalityIntraoral scanner technology is characterized by a range of systems tailor-made to different scientific desires, presenting varied capabilities that stretch their utility across dental specialties. The core of those units typically entails State-of-the-art optical units—such as confocal microscopy, triangulation, or Lively wavefront sampling—that capture the interior on the mouth with incredible depth. The choice of technologies influences the scanner’s accuracy, velocity, and simplicity of use, with a few styles optimized for set restorations while others excel in orthodontics or implantology.Functionally, fashionable intraoral scanners Incorporate mild resources, higher-definition cameras, and complicated software package algorithms to generate exact 3D digital styles. These equipment normally attribute ergonomic styles, intuitive interfaces, and wireless connectivity to boost usability. Some scanners incorporate supplemental functionalities such as incorporating coloured imaging for superior tissue differentiation or combining with facial scanners for thorough electronic smile style and design. The continuing technological evolution regularly expands their abilities, producing intraoral scanners extra flexible and elementary to thorough digital workflows. Medical Applications of Intraoral Scanners - An Expanding ScopeThe scientific programs of intraoral scanners are impressively broad, extending well beyond uncomplicated electronic impressions. In restorative dentistry, they aid the design and fabrication of crowns, bridges, inlays, and onlays with Fantastic precision, cutting down turnaround time and boosting match top quality. In orthodontics, intraoral scans aid clear aligner therapy and electronic crown repositioning, building remedy arranging much more predictable and affected individual-friendly. Their capacity to make precise designs quickly also proves a must have in complex circumstances for instance smile design and style or smooth tissue analysis.Because the medical scope widens, intraoral scanners are more and more remaining adopted in implantology, allowing for for specific virtual scheduling of implant placement and electronic fabrication of surgical guides. Their job in TMJ assessment, periodontal evaluation, and oral pathology documentation can be gaining recognition, supporting in depth diagnostic techniques.
